How do I get my Saint Mary's ID card and how do I get it replaced?
Students, faculty, and staff needing a Saint Mary's ID card can get one by visiting the Helpdesk. You will need to show government-issued identification (driver's license, passport) before a Saint Mary's ID card will created for you. You should obtain your Saint Mary's ID card within your first week on campus.
If you need a new Saint Mary's ID card because:
the photo on your old card is no longer visible (a common problem after numerous swipes through the residence hall detex card readers and dining hall visits), please bring the card with you to the Helpdesk for a replacement.
the mag stripe (for detex) or the junk stripe (for laundry and vending machine money) on the card can no longer be read, please bring the card with you to the Helpdesk for a replacement.
your old card has broken, please bring the pieces with you to the Helpdesk for a replacement. You will need to bring over 50% of your broken card with you to not be charged a $15.00 replacement fee.
your old card was lost, you will need to pay a $15.00 replacement fee. Please visit the Cashier's Window in Le Mans Hall (near the Financial Aid offices) to pay the fee, and bring the receipt with you to have a new ID card made. (If your ID card is lost/stolen after the Helpdesk closes for the day or during a weekend, students need to visit the Security Building and request a temporary missing card from the dispatcher. The temporary card may be used to eat in the dining hall for a limited time or until the ID card is replaced. The temporary card will not work for the Detex system.)
New ID cards will not be made for unnecessary reasons, such as not liking the picture that is on the card.
